Introduction

In the world of speech-language pathology, understanding the broader social determinants of health is crucial for creating effective interventions. The research article "The Impact of Invisibility on the Health of Migrant Farmworkers in the Southeastern United States: A Case Study from Georgia" provides valuable insights into the unique challenges faced by migrant farmworkers. These insights can significantly inform and enhance the practice of healthcare professionals, including speech-language pathologists, especially those working with underserved populations.

The Invisible Workforce

Migrant farmworkers are a vital yet often invisible part of the agricultural industry in the United States. The research highlights how these workers, primarily from Latin America, face significant health challenges due to their marginalized status. The invisibility of farmworkers within institutions such as healthcare, education, and social services exacerbates their health issues, leading to poor health outcomes.

Encouraging Further Research

While this study provides valuable insights, there is a need for further research to explore the specific speech and language challenges faced by migrant farmworkers' children. Practitioners are encouraged to engage in research that examines how these broader social determinants impact language development and communication skills.

For more detailed insights, I encourage you to read the original research paper, The Impact of Invisibility on the Health of Migrant Farmworkers in the Southeastern United States: A Case Study from Georgia.


Citation: Bail, K. M., Foster, J., Dalmida, S. G., Kelly, U., Howett, M., Ferranti, E. P., & Wold, J. (2012). The impact of invisibility on the health of migrant farmworkers in the southeastern United States: A case study from Georgia. Nursing Research and Practice, 2012, Article 760418. https://doi.org/10.1155/2012/760418
